School reform: COAG Communiqué

The Council of Australian Governments (COAG) meeting on 19 April has discussed the Australian Government's proposals for school funding without reaching agreement on key issues. Victorian Government and AEU leaders reach in-principle agreement on pay

The Victorian Government and Australian Education Union have reached an in-principle agreement covering principals, teachers and education support staff in Victorian government schools, following an industrial campaign in support of pay rises. Draft Australian Curriculum: Technologies F–10 released

ACARA is conducting consultation on the draft Australian Curriculum: Technologies Foundation to Year 10. This includes consultation on Design and Technologies and Digital Technologies. The consultation closes on 10 May 2013. ACARA welcomes and encourages feedback on these draft curriculum materials.

Queensland Government plan to improve teacher quality

The Queensland Government's recently announced plan to improve teacher quality, Great Teachers = Great Results, has received widepread attention in the media. See, for example, video from the Brisbane Times 9 April and article in The Courier-Mail 11 April 2013.
